People

Greg Womer has joined the law firm of Luvaas Cobb in Eugene. A graduate of the University of Oregon School of Law, he will focus on estate planning, trusts, and business and corporate law. Womer previously worked as a branch manager for Wells Fargo Financial.

Hakimu Jackson has been named account executive in the Portland market for Eugene-based Chambers Communications. He will organize Portland sales efforts for Chambers Communications broadcast businesses. Jackson most recently worked as sales manager for Millennium Sales and Marketing in Portland.
